West Somerset Railway

The West Somerset Railway is one of the UK’s most substantial heritage railway days out, running between Bishops Lydeard and Minehead through Somerset countryside, coastal scenery and classic Great Western Railway branch-line atmosphere.

Why West Somerset Railway Is Special

West Somerset Railway stands out because it feels like a proper branch-line journey rather than a short preserved railway ride. The route connects inland Somerset with the coast, giving visitors a mix of countryside, villages, seaside appeal and railway heritage.

  • Long heritage railway journey
    The line gives visitors enough distance to settle into the experience and make the railway itself the centre of the day.
  • Seaside destination at Minehead
    Minehead adds a strong family and holiday angle, turning the trip into more than a train ride.
  • Great Western Railway atmosphere
    The branch-line feel, stations and landscape make it especially appealing to railway enthusiasts.

Route, Stations and Highlights

The West Somerset Railway route links inland Somerset with the coast, making it one of the most varied heritage railway journeys in England.

  • Bishops Lydeard
    The main southern starting point, close to Taunton and useful for visitors travelling from the M5 corridor.
  • Crowcombe Heathfield
    A rural station with strong countryside atmosphere and traditional branch-line character.
  • Stogumber
    A quieter intermediate stop suited to visitors who enjoy rural station settings.
  • Williton
    A key intermediate station and useful operating point on the route.
  • Watchet
    A harbour-town stop with coastal and heritage appeal.
  • Blue Anchor
    A seaside stop that adds coastal scenery and holiday atmosphere to the line.
  • Dunster
    A useful stop for visitors interested in the historic village and castle area.
  • Minehead
    The seaside terminus and one of the strongest reasons the railway works as a full day out.

Frequently Asked Questions

Where is the West Somerset Railway? The West Somerset Railway is in Somerset, running between Bishops Lydeard near Taunton and Minehead on the coast.
Is West Somerset Railway good for families? Yes. The long route, seaside destination, station variety and events programme make it one of the strongest family railway days out in the UK.
What is the best way to visit West Somerset Railway? A full-line return between Bishops Lydeard and Minehead is the classic option, while shorter journeys and dining trains work well for specific occasions.
